**About the Role**

Are you passionate about clinical coding, data integrity and making a real impact in healthcare? As a Coding & Documentation Auditor at Central Adelaide Local Health Network (CALHN), you’ll play a key role in auditing clinical documentation and ICD-10-AM/ACHI coding to ensure compliance with national and state standards. You'll help shape the quality of our coded data through continual audit activity, contributing directly to accurate Activity Based Funding (ABF) outcomes and timely data submissions.

In this engaging role, you’ll work closely with coding teams, providing up-to-date education and insights from audit findings to support continuous improvement. You’ll be part of a collaborative, supportive environment where your skills are valued, and your contributions make a difference to both patient care data and revenue optimisation. **About You**

You are a detail-oriented professional with a passion for data integrity, coding accuracy, and improving healthcare outcomes. With strong technical expertise and a collaborative approach, you're ready to support quality coding and documentation standards at CALHN.
- Hold a Diploma of Clinical Coding (HLT50321) or equivalent, with demonstrated advanced competency in ICD-10-AM
- Bring experience in clinical coding auditing, documentation improvement, and staff education in a large healthcare setting
- Possess str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ills with the ability to work independently and manage competing priorities
- Have exc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to build strong working relationships and contribute to a team-focused environment
